Universal τ1/2(y) Isgur-Wise Function at the Next-to-Leading Order in QCD Sum Rules
Abstract
We use QCD sum rules, in the framework of the Heavy Quark Effective Theory, to calculate the universal form factor τ1/2(y) parameterizing the semileptonic transitions B D0 , B D1* , where D0 and D*1 are the members of the excited charmed doublet with JP=(0+1/2,1+1/2). We include two-loop corrections in the perturbative contribution to the sum rule, and present a complete next-to-leading order result. As a preliminary part of our analysis we also compute, up to order αs, the leptonic constant F+ of the doublet D0, D1*. Finally, we discuss the phenomenological implications of this calculation.
